Jacaranda Tales: A Film Festival on Women and Nature
Jacaranda Tales is a celebration of women's symbiotic relationship with nature, recognizing their often overlooked contributions to nurturing of the environment. The 4 day festival hopes to create awareness on environmental issues, cutting across barriers of class, gender and literacy using the power of the audio-visual format. Panel discussions with eminent environmentalists and film makers will bring together women leading these efforts, and their stories, to develop insights into their extraordinary lives and struggles. Birdsong Exhibition
Early Bird is delighted to be partnering with the Indian Music Experience Museum in Bangalore for an upcoming exhibit called Birdsong. This is an exhibition curated by the museum that spotlights the contribution of birds to our ecological and cultural wealth. It opens on 1 Apr 2022 and entry to the birdsong exhibit will be free on 1-2 April (and will be priced at a nominal amount thereafter).
